Using this resource will help students with reading, spelling, pronunciation and possibly increase English vocabulary. Often resources for doing phonic work have words without pictures. This is not ideal for students who are learning English. All the words used in this resource have visual support, so that learning the sounds of a combination of two letters is incorporated with learning additional English vocabulary. As with most of my resources, reference pages are included so that students can successfully complete worksheets, play games and take part in activities. This enables students to work independently at times and builds confidence in using the four skills of listening, speaking, reading and writing. When playing the dominoes game, naming the items and reading the words as cards are placed on the table helps with the retention of new vocabulary. This resource is printable. Laminating games is recommended.
The same vocabulary (listed below the contents) is used in the different tasks to reinforce the targeted vocabulary.
